Torino midfielder Joel Obi will be sidelined for a week, his club have announced.
The midfielder underwent tests on Thursday after persisting symptoms of pains to the flexor muscle of the left thigh.
The club said in a statement on its official website that Obi is suffering from overload on the leg: “MRI he underwent Obi showed an overuse the semitendinosus muscle of the left thigh. Recovery times are currently estimated at approximately 5-7 days.
The former Inter Milan midfielder is among 18 foreign-based professionals called up for a 2017 Africa Cup of Nations (Afcon) qualifier against Tanzania by Nigeria coach Sunday Oliseh.
